- Brief Summary
This is a prospective and interventional randomised comparative study to compare the effect of IV Dexmedetomidine with IV Dexmedetomidine-Dexamethasone combination with Normal Saline as control in preventing PONV in patients following abdominal surgeries under general anaesthesia using a Numerical Rating Scale in 75 patients of ASA physical status I/II of either gender of 18-60 years of age. The primary outcome measured will be incidence/frequency/severity of Nausea and incidence/frequency of Vomiting at regular time intervals post-op for up to 24 hours. The secondary outcomes measured will be post-op sedation using Ramsay Sedation Scale and post-op pain using Visual Analog Scale.
